Scionic Merkle DAGs are actually much better than IPFS Merkle DAGs.

Plus, IPFS focuses on a P2P model that forces everyone to become a server — whereas Nostr is a user-server model with paid servers.

Specifically, Scionic Merkle DAGs have much smaller branches with far fewer useless hashes needed to create the same proof. It scales logarithmically, see stats below: https://github.com/HORNET-Storage/scionic-merkletree

People may need to cut on bandwidth and thus need to reduce amount of connections to NOSTR relays. Only dedicated relays for specific services and top 3 "global nostr" relays will be selected then. In other words: a relay needs to be really popular some point in order to stay in the top3 and thus the top 3 are a centralizing point of failure.
